I was given a Celestron 70 travel scope outfit for my birthday. It's been really cloudy here recently and last night was the first night we had a clear view of Venus.

We used 20mm, 10mm & 4mm lenses and discovered Venus to have a line straight through the middle. It looked almost like the lens was cracked or had a hair on it but we've checked it and it seems fine. We've also looked at our blossom tree at the bottom of our garden in daylight and no line appears.

Am I being really silly or is there a reason for this?

Looking at the sun the other day my other half noticed a line going through it and started sweeping her hair back and asking if there was an eyelash on the lens. Turns out it was an overhead telephone line lol.

Sounds daft but quite realistic and they're harder to spot at night - might be worth checking if you have any lines in that direction :)
